After lunch in Turkish cuisine, our tour starts from the Topkapi Museum that exhibits the imperial collections of the Ottoman Empire and maintains an extensive collection of books and manuscripts in its library. It is housed in a palace complex that served as the administrative center and residence of the imperial Ottoman court from about 1478 to 1856. It opened as a museum in 1924, a year after the establishment of the Republic of Turkey. The Topkapi Palace Museum is notable not only for its architecture and collections but also for the history and culture of the Ottoman Empire with first, second, third and fourth courtyards, the audience hall, Divan the high court, historical kitchens, royal stables, the treasury, gardens, and kiosks that it recalls.

Our tour will start from the first breach of the city walls from the Fourth Crusade in 1204, the second by the cannons and troops of Sultan Mehmet the Conqueror in 1453.
Next, we will drive through a natural and extremely secure harbor the Golden Horn which has played an important role in the development of Istanbul. The inlet separates the European shore into two. It is approximately 8 km long, and the widest part is the entrance from the Bosphorus. Two streams drain into this inlet at its far end.
Spice Bazaar (Egyptian Bazaar) The air here is filled with the enticing aromas of cinnamon, caraway, saffron, mint, thyme and every other conceivable herb and spice.

After lunch, we will first drive over the first intercontinental bridge called Bosphorus Bridge that connects Europe and Asia continents. Bosphorus Bridge was built in 1973 having a length between two legs is 1074 meters. At the time of construction, it was the fourth-longest suspension bridge of the world.
After reaching the Asian part of Istanbul through Bosphorus Bridge our bus will take you to Camlica Hill with a height of 268 meters makes it the highest peak of Istanbul.
